I have all the boxscores from the 1985 season. I’m doing it as part of a quest to get more information than currently available online about the USFL’s final season. The various sources come from local newspapers. I will create a section of Sycarion that is just for the completed boxscores.
Game 1 in Tampa Bay with 44,0095 in attendance broke down like this:
Team ———-Q1 — Q2 — Q3 — Q4 —- Total
Renegades —-0 —– 0 —– 0 —– 7 ——— 7
Bandits ——- 14 — 14 —– 7 —– 0 ——- 35
Neither team threw for more than 162 yards. It was a running game, if you can believe that.

Sycarion Diversions is a sister site of pinakidion.*. pinakidion.* deals more with religious and writing topics. This site houses information on games. Specifically, this has information on card games, board games, and role-playing games. Card games and board games are a collaborative effort with my friend Jeff. Jeff has created and briefly marketed one board game and has idea for lots of others. Role-Playing Games are my bailiwick. I've been playing since I was 10 starting with the Mentzer Basic D&D box. I stopped playing in college, but recently renewed my love for RPGs. In 2005, I discovered the Action! System from Goldrush Games. Since then, I have also found Microlite20 and OpenD6. It's a good time to game.
